Accessing your Raspberry Pi remotely from a Windows 10 device is not only possible but also incredibly useful for tech-savvy users. Imagine being able to control your home automation system, monitor security cameras, or manage your personal server from anywhere in the world. Sounds awesome, right? But how exactly do you set it up? Don’t worry; we’ve got you covered. In this article, we’ll walk you through everything you need to know about remote Raspberry Pi access on Windows 10.
Whether you’re a beginner or an experienced hobbyist, remote access can save you time and effort. Instead of physically sitting in front of your Raspberry Pi, you can manage it from your cozy desk, a coffee shop, or even while lounging on the beach. However, setting up remote access requires some preparation, and that’s where this guide comes in handy.
From configuring SSH to using VNC and other tools, we’ll break down the process step by step. By the end of this article, you’ll have a solid understanding of how to remotely access your Raspberry Pi from your Windows 10 machine. Let’s dive in!
- Teri Garr Remembering A Beloved Actress Comedian Tributes Pour In
- Donnie Wahlberg Net Worth 2024 How Rich Is He
Table of Contents:
- Why Remote Access Matters
- Setting Up Your Raspberry Pi for Remote Access
- Using SSH for Remote Access
- Using VNC for Remote Access
- Other Tools You Can Use
- Securing Your Remote Connection
- Troubleshooting Common Issues
- Benefits of Remote Access
- Comparison of Remote Access Methods
- Conclusion and Next Steps
Why Remote Access Matters
Remote access isn’t just a cool feature; it’s a necessity for modern tech enthusiasts. Whether you’re running a web server, managing IoT devices, or just tinkering with your Raspberry Pi, being able to control it from afar is a game-changer. For instance, imagine you’re on vacation and you need to check your home security cameras. With remote access, you can do that without missing a beat.
Key Benefits of Remote Access
Here’s a quick rundown of why remote access is so important:
- Aliza Barber The Untold Story Of Young Sheldons Wife Chef
- Orca 1977 The Revenge Thriller You Need To See Today
- Convenience: Access your Raspberry Pi from anywhere.
- Efficiency: Save time by managing tasks remotely.
- Flexibility: Work on your projects even when you’re not at home.
Now that you know why remote access matters, let’s dive into the setup process.
Setting Up Your Raspberry Pi for Remote Access
Before you can access your Raspberry Pi remotely, you’ll need to make sure it’s properly configured. This involves setting up your Raspberry Pi, ensuring it’s connected to the internet, and enabling the necessary services. Here’s how you can do it:
Step 1: Install Raspberry Pi OS
First things first, you’ll need to install Raspberry Pi OS on your device. If you haven’t done this yet, download the Raspberry Pi Imager from the official website and follow the installation instructions. Once your OS is up and running, update it using the following commands:
sudo apt update && sudo apt upgrade
Step 2: Connect to the Internet
Make sure your Raspberry Pi is connected to your local network either via Wi-Fi or Ethernet. You’ll need a stable internet connection for remote access to work properly.
Step 3: Enable SSH and VNC
SSH and VNC are two of the most popular methods for remote access. Let’s enable them on your Raspberry Pi:
- For SSH: Go to the Raspberry Pi Configuration menu, navigate to the Interfaces tab, and enable SSH.
- For VNC: Install the VNC Server by running sudo apt install realvnc-vnc-server realvnc-vnc-viewer.
That’s it for the setup! Now let’s move on to the actual remote access methods.
Using SSH for Remote Access
SSH (Secure Shell) is one of the simplest and most secure ways to access your Raspberry Pi remotely. It allows you to control your device via the command line. Here’s how you can set it up:
Step 1: Find Your Raspberry Pi’s IP Address
Open the terminal on your Raspberry Pi and type:
hostname -I
This will display your device’s IP address. Make a note of it, as you’ll need it later.
Step 2: Install an SSH Client on Windows 10
Windows 10 comes with a built-in SSH client. You can use it by opening the Command Prompt or PowerShell and typing:
ssh pi@your_raspberry_pi_ip_address
Replace "your_raspberry_pi_ip_address" with the actual IP address of your Raspberry Pi. When prompted, enter the password for your Raspberry Pi (default is "raspberry").
Step 3: Start Using SSH
Once connected, you can start running commands on your Raspberry Pi as if you were sitting in front of it. SSH is perfect for tasks like file management, system updates, and scripting.
Using VNC for Remote Access
If you prefer a graphical interface, VNC is the way to go. It allows you to see and interact with your Raspberry Pi’s desktop environment from your Windows 10 machine. Here’s how to set it up:
Step 1: Install VNC Viewer on Windows 10
Download and install the VNC Viewer app from the official website. It’s free for personal use and super easy to set up.
Step 2: Connect to Your Raspberry Pi
Open VNC Viewer and enter your Raspberry Pi’s IP address. You’ll be prompted to enter your device’s password. Once connected, you’ll see your Raspberry Pi’s desktop on your Windows 10 screen.
Step 3: Start Exploring
With VNC, you can use your Raspberry Pi just like any other computer. It’s great for tasks that require a graphical interface, such as web browsing, image editing, or running GUI-based applications.
Other Tools You Can Use
SSH and VNC are the most popular methods for remote access, but there are other tools you might want to explore:
TeamViewer
TeamViewer is a powerful remote access tool that works across multiple platforms, including Windows 10 and Raspberry Pi. It’s easy to set up and offers features like file transfer and remote printing.
Remote Desktop Protocol (RDP)
RDP is another option for remote access. While it’s not as lightweight as SSH or VNC, it’s great for more advanced users who need additional features.
Other Tools
There are plenty of other tools available, such as NoMachine, AnyDesk, and PuTTY. Each has its own strengths and weaknesses, so it’s worth experimenting to see which one works best for you.
Securing Your Remote Connection
Security is a top priority when it comes to remote access. Here are some tips to keep your Raspberry Pi safe:
- Use strong passwords and enable two-factor authentication.
- Update your Raspberry Pi regularly to patch security vulnerabilities.
- Consider using a firewall to restrict access to your device.
- Monitor your logs for suspicious activity.
By following these best practices, you can ensure that your remote connection is as secure as possible.
Troubleshooting Common Issues
Even with the best preparation, things can sometimes go wrong. Here are some common issues you might encounter and how to fix them:
Issue 1: Can’t Connect to Raspberry Pi
Make sure your Raspberry Pi is connected to the same network as your Windows 10 machine. Also, double-check the IP address and ensure that SSH or VNC is enabled.
Issue 2: Slow Connection
A slow connection could be due to network congestion or a weak Wi-Fi signal. Try using Ethernet instead of Wi-Fi for a more stable connection.
Issue 3: Authentication Failed
Check that you’re entering the correct username and password. If you’ve changed the default password, make sure you’re using the updated one.
Benefits of Remote Access
Now that you know how to set up remote access, let’s talk about the benefits:
- Increased productivity: Manage your Raspberry Pi projects from anywhere.
- Cost savings: No need to buy additional hardware for remote work.
- Flexibility: Work on your projects at your own pace and convenience.
Remote access truly opens up a world of possibilities for Raspberry Pi users.
Comparison of Remote Access Methods
Here’s a quick comparison of the most popular remote access methods:
Method | Pros | Cons |
---|---|---|
SSH | Simple, secure, lightweight | Command-line only |
VNC | Graphical interface, easy to use | Slower than SSH |
TeamViewer | Feature-rich, cross-platform | Can be resource-heavy |
Choose the method that best suits your needs and skill level.
Conclusion and Next Steps
Remote access to your Raspberry Pi from Windows 10 is easier than you might think. With tools like SSH, VNC, and TeamViewer, you can manage your device from anywhere in the world. Just remember to prioritize security and troubleshoot any issues that arise.
Now that you’ve learned how to set up remote access, why not try it out for yourself? Start by enabling SSH or VNC on your Raspberry Pi and connecting from your Windows 10 machine. Once you get the hang of it, you’ll wonder how you ever managed without it.
Don’t forget to leave a comment below and share this article with your fellow Raspberry Pi enthusiasts. Happy tinkering!



Detail Author:
- Name : Dr. Waldo Hahn DVM
- Username : nicolas96
- Email : west.llewellyn@lynch.biz
- Birthdate : 1984-03-18
- Address : 9403 Kutch Circles Apt. 821 West Jesse, MO 80674
- Phone : 1-337-610-5008
- Company : Langosh, Rempel and Littel
- Job : Criminal Investigator
- Bio : Ut laudantium quidem aut doloribus sequi. Laborum quis eum ex id iusto. Eum eius ut nulla repudiandae.
Socials
instagram:
- url : https://instagram.com/moses_windler
- username : moses_windler
- bio : Iure et magnam ad assumenda minima laboriosam. Necessitatibus esse dolore voluptatum ducimus.
- followers : 6896
- following : 1062
facebook:
- url : https://facebook.com/moses8244
- username : moses8244
- bio : Ut quas voluptatibus est rem et modi. Et et amet ab ea.
- followers : 4855
- following : 2515
linkedin:
- url : https://linkedin.com/in/moseswindler
- username : moseswindler
- bio : Soluta neque possimus labore quae atque est.
- followers : 6577
- following : 2111
tiktok:
- url : https://tiktok.com/@moses_official
- username : moses_official
- bio : Saepe quisquam enim dolores facere. Quia non qui optio in.
- followers : 1679
- following : 1896